How to Customize EVA Cases: A Complete Guide for Brands and Manufacturers

Custom EVA (Ethylene-Vinyl Acetate) cases have become one of the most popular packaging and storage solutions for modern products—from electronics and tools to medical devices, watches, cosmetics, and outdoor gear. Their combination of durability, lightweight structure, and premium appearance makes them an ideal choice for brands seeking both protection and professional presentation. If your business is considering a custom EVA case, this guide will walk you step-by-step through the entire process so you can develop the perfect case for your product line.

1. Define the Purpose of Your EVA Case

Before designing your case, clearly determine its main purpose:

  • Shockproof protection

  • Water resistance

  • Premium retail packaging

  • Travel and portability

  • Equipment organization

  • Medical or safety storage

Understanding the purpose helps manufacturers optimize the shape, structure, and materials.

2. Choose the Structure and Shape

EVA cases can be customized in many forms, depending on your product:

  • Clamshell structure (most common)

  • Zippered hard shell

  • Drawer or slider style

  • Fully molded silhouette

  • Multi-layer compartment designs

When defining the structure, consider:

  • Case depth

  • Opening angle

  • Number of compartments

  • Overall hardness

  • Fit for the product shape

3. Select the Outer Material

The fabric covering the EVA shell plays a major role in durability and branding. Popular options include:

  • 1680D / 1200D / 600D Polyester

  • Nylon

  • PU leather

  • Carbon fiber pattern

  • Waterproof TPU fabric

  • Textured EVA surface

Each material offers a different look, feel, and performance level.

4. Design the Inner Structure

The interior should securely fit and protect your product. Common designs include:

  • Molded EVA tray

  • Custom-cut EVA foam

  • PU foam padding

  • Mesh pockets

  • Divider panels

  • Elastic straps

For delicate electronics or tools, a molded internal tray gives the best protection.
For accessories or travel kits, mesh pockets or dividers may be more suitable.

5. Add Custom Branding & Logo Options

Brand identity is essential in professional packaging. EVA cases support multiple logo techniques:

  • Heat-pressed logo (most popular)

  • Silk-screen printing

  • Rubber patch

  • Metal plate

  • Embossed / debossed logo

Heat-pressed and embossed logos provide a premium, long-lasting finish.

6. Customize Zippers and Accessories

Small accessories significantly influence the user experience and perceived quality:

  • Nylon zipper / waterproof zipper / reverse zipper

  • Custom zipper pullers (metal or rubber)

  • Woven or rubber handles

  • Shoulder straps

  • Carabiner hooks

  • Nameplates or tags

Custom zipper pullers with your brand logo create a strong brand identity.

7. Confirm Dimensions & Request a 3D Drawing

Precision is crucial. To ensure a perfect fit:

  • Provide accurate product dimensions

  • Supplier creates a 3D rendering or structural layout

  • Review and adjust until final approval

A reliable manufacturer will always offer 3D design support before sampling.

8. Sample Production

After confirming the design, a prototype sample is produced. This includes:

  • Molded EVA shell

  • Outer fabric and color

  • Logo effect

  • Internal layout

Typical sample lead time: 7–12 days, depending on complexity.

9. Mass Production & Quality Control

Once the sample is approved, production begins.
Quality inspection includes:

  • Material hardness

  • Zipper smoothness

  • Stitching accuracy

  • Logo quality

  • Shape consistency

  • Interior fit

Production time: 20–30 days, depending on order quantity.

10. Packaging and Shipping

After production, your EVA cases can be packed in:

  • PE bags

  • Custom retail boxes

  • Cartons for shipment

Shipping options include air freight, sea freight, or express delivery.
